What Are Bobbleheads?
Bobbleheads, also known as nodders, are collectible figurines with oversized heads mounted on springs. When touched, their heads bobble or nod, giving them a unique and playful charm. These figurines are often modeled after famous athletes, celebrities, fictional characters, or even custom designs.
Bobbleheads have become a popular collectible item worldwide, cherished for their quirky appeal and personalization options. Whether you're a sports fan, movie buff, or just love unique memorabilia, bobbleheads offer something for everyone.
The History of Bobbleheads
The origins of bobbleheads date back to the 18th century, with early versions appearing in German porcelain figurines. However, the modern bobblehead as we know it gained popularity in the 1960s, thanks to Major League Baseball (MLB) teams. The first wave of bobbleheads featured baseball players, and their popularity soared as fans eagerly collected them.
In the 2000s, bobbleheads experienced a resurgence, with sports teams, movie studios, and brands using them as promotional items. Today, they are a staple in pop culture, with countless designs and themes available.

The Future of Bobbleheads
As technology advances, bobbleheads are evolving too. Some modern bobbleheads now feature LED lights, sound effects, or even motion sensors. These innovations are making bobbleheads more interactive and engaging than ever before.
Additionally, the rise of 3D printing has opened up new possibilities for customization. Fans can now create highly detailed and accurate bobbleheads of virtually anyone or anything.
Bobbleheads in Pop Culture
Bobbleheads have made their mark in movies, TV shows, and even video games. They are often used as Easter eggs or collectible items within these mediums, further cementing their place in pop culture.
For example, in the popular TV show "The Office," Dwight Schrute's bobblehead is a recurring gag that fans love. Similarly, in the video game "Fallout," bobbleheads are collectible items that provide in-game bonuses.
